Troubleshooting Wi-Fi Issues
To fix Wi-Fi issues on PC, users can follow a series of troubleshooting steps. These steps include checking the physical connections, restarting the router and PC, and updating network drivers.
Checking Physical Connections
The first step in troubleshooting Wi-Fi issues is to check the physical connections between the PC and the router. Ensure that the Wi-Fi switch is turned on and that the PC is within range of the router’s signal. If using an Ethernet cable, verify that it is securely connected to both the PC and the router.
Restarting the Router and PC
Restarting the router and PC can often resolve Wi-Fi connectivity issues. This simple step can reset network settings and clear temporary glitches. To restart the router, unplug the power cord, wait for 30 seconds, and then plug it back in. Similarly, restart the PC by clicking on the Start menu and selecting the Restart option.
Software Updates and Network Driver Installation
Outdated or corrupted network drivers can cause Wi-Fi issues on PCs. Updating network drivers and installing the latest software updates can resolve these problems.
Updating Network Drivers
To update network drivers, follow these steps:
Step | Instructions |
---|---|
1 | Press the Windows key + X and select Device Manager |
2 | Expand the Network Adapters section and right-click on the Wi-Fi adapter |
3 | Select Update driver and follow the prompts to search for and install updates |
Installing Software Updates
Installing the latest software updates can also resolve Wi-Fi issues on PCs. To install software updates, follow these steps:
- Click on the Start menu and select Settings
- Click on Update & Security and then select Windows Update
- Click on Check for updates and follow the prompts to download and install any available updates
Advanced Troubleshooting Methods
If the above steps do not resolve the Wi-Fi issue, users can try advanced troubleshooting methods, including resetting network settings and performing a system restore.
Resetting Network Settings
Resetting network settings can resolve Wi-Fi issues caused by corrupted network configurations. To reset network settings, follow these steps:
- Click on the Start menu and select Settings
- Click on Network & Internet and then select Status
- Click on Network reset and follow the prompts to reset network settings
Performing a System Restore
Performing a system restore can resolve Wi-Fi issues caused by recent software changes. To perform a system restore, follow these steps:
- Click on the Start menu and select Control Panel
- Click on Recovery and then select Open System Restore
- Follow the prompts to select a restore point and restore the system

What is the difference between a Wi-Fi adapter and a network card?
A Wi-Fi adapter and a network card are both hardware components that enable a PC to connect to a network, but they serve different purposes. A Wi-Fi adapter is a hardware component that allows a PC to connect to a wireless network, while a network card, also known as an Ethernet card, enables a PC to connect to a wired network using an Ethernet cable. Wi-Fi adapters use radio waves to transmit and receive data, while network cards use a physical connection to transmit data. In terms of functionality, Wi-Fi adapters provide greater flexibility and mobility, as they allow users to connect to the internet from anywhere within range of the wireless network.
In contrast, network cards provide a more stable and secure connection, as they are less susceptible to interference and hacking. However, they require a physical connection to the router or switch, which can limit mobility. Many modern PCs come with both a Wi-Fi adapter and a network card, allowing users to choose the connection method that best suits their needs. What is the purpose of a Wi-Fi analyzer tool?
A Wi-Fi analyzer tool is a software application that helps users to analyze and troubleshoot their Wi-Fi connection. The primary purpose of a Wi-Fi analyzer tool is to identify issues with the Wi-Fi signal, such as channel overlap, interference, and weak signal strength. These tools can scan the surrounding area and detect nearby Wi-Fi networks, allowing users to identify potential sources of interference. Additionally, Wi-Fi analyzer tools can provide detailed information about the Wi-Fi connection, including the signal strength, channel usage, and data transfer rates.
By using a Wi-Fi analyzer tool, users can identify and resolve issues with their Wi-Fi connection, such as slow data transfer rates, dropped connections, and poor signal strength. These tools can also help users to optimize their Wi-Fi network by identifying the best channel to use, adjusting the Wi-Fi adapter settings, and positioning the router for optimal coverage. How do I reset my Wi-Fi adapter?
Resetting the Wi-Fi adapter is a troubleshooting step that can help to resolve connectivity issues and restore the Wi-Fi connection. The process of resetting the Wi-Fi adapter varies depending on the operating system and Wi-Fi adapter model. On Windows PCs, users can reset the Wi-Fi adapter by going to the Device Manager, right-clicking on the Wi-Fi adapter, and selecting “Disable device”. After disabling the device, users can wait for a few seconds and then enable it again. This can help to reset the Wi-Fi adapter and resolve connectivity issues.
Alternatively, users can also reset the Wi-Fi adapter by using the Windows Network Reset tool, which can be accessed by going to the Settings app, clicking on “Network & Internet”, and selecting “Status”. From there, users can click on “Network reset” and follow the prompts to reset the Wi-Fi adapter. Resetting the Wi-Fi adapter can help to resolve issues such as dropped connections, slow data transfer rates, and poor signal strength.
